🙋🏻‍♂️ Self-Diagnosis Checklist

 

After the class, you will be able to clearly know and understand the following concepts.

  • I have a clear understanding of the concept of Dispatch Queue. (Yes/No)
  • I understand the types of DispatchQueues and Quality of Service (QoS). (Yes/No)
  • I know why the Sync method should not be used in most cases, and I understand the difference regarding cases where the Sync method must be used. (Yes/No)
  • I understand the concept of Dispatch Groups. (Yes/No)
  • I know what to be careful about when dealing with asynchronous functions in a Dispatch Group. (Yes/No)
  • I understand the concept of Dispatch Work Item and know why it is used. (Yes/No)
  • Dispatch Semaphore I understand the concept of and know how to use it. (Yes/No)
  • When designing objects, I clearly understand the precautions regarding the possibility of access by multiple threads and can design correct objects. (Yes/No)
  • I clearly understand the points to be cautious about when handling asynchronous concepts while creating table view/collection view type projects that download images. (Yes/No)
  • I clearly understand the problems that can occur when using Dispatch Queues (when multiple threads access data), especially Race Conditions, and I know how to use TSan (Thread Sanitizer Tool). (Yes/No)
  • I clearly understand how to write thread-safe code. (Yes/No)
  • I understand the concept of Operations, which are an extension of Dispatch Queues, and their differences. (Yes/No)
  • I can distinguish and decide when to use OperationQueue instead of DispatchQueue. (Yes/No)
  • I understand the code for AsyncOperation, which can handle asynchronous functions. (Yes/No)
  • Key features of Operation (setting the order of tasks, cancellation) can be used freely. (Yes/No)
